Hi,
I hope you’re doing well!
Please look at the requirements below, let us know of your interest, and send us your updated resume to [email protected]
Role: Python Engineer
Location – Bellevue- Washington state
Job Description:
- Software Development: Write efficient, reusable, and maintainable code in Perl and Python to automate tasks and support backend systems.
- Unix & Scripting: Leverage Unix systems to write Shell scripts for automating processes, managing data, and optimizing system performance.
- System Integration: Design and integrate backend components and services to ensure seamless communication between systems and applications.
- Troubleshooting & Optimization: Diagnose issues, optimize performance, and ensure the stability and scalability of the systems.
- Collaboration: Work closely with cross-functional teams (DevOps, QA, etc.) to deliver robust, scalable solutions.
- Documentation: Create and maintain comprehensive documentation for scripts, codebases, and system configurations.
- Mentorship: Mentor junior engineers, review code, and provide guidance on best practices in Perl, Python, and system administration.
Good to Have Skills:
- Hadoop: Experience with Hadoop ecosystems for large-scale data processing.
- Kafka: Familiarity with Kafka for real-time data streaming and message brokering.
- Network/Telecom Domain Knowledge: Understanding of the networking and telecom domains, including protocols, data transmission, and system architectures.
- Web Development: Exposure to web development technologies, particularly in the context of backend services.
Key Skills and Experience:
- Perl: Extensive experience writing Perl scripts for data processing, system automation, and backend tasks.
- Python: Strong experience with Python, especially for backend development, automation, and integration tasks.
- Unix: Proficiency in Unix/Linux systems and familiarity with system-level programming and administration.
- Shell Scripting: Strong knowledge of Shell scripting (Bash, Korn, etc.) for automation and system management.
Desirable Skills:
- Hadoop: Familiarity with big data processing frameworks like Hadoop, and related tools (Hive, Pig, etc.).
- Kafka: Knowledge of Kafka for message streaming and integrating distributed systems.
- Network/Telecom Knowledge: Understanding of telecom protocols, network troubleshooting, and telecom infrastructure.
- Web Development: Experience in building web services, RESTful APIs, or web applications.
With Regards
Kishore Reddy
|